متن کاملAdaptive Nulling with Weight Constraints
Adaptive nulling algorithms that minimize the total array output power from the array require constraints on the adaptive weights, otherwise nulls would be placed in the main beam and the desired signal rejected. متن کاملNumerical properties of the linearly constrained QRD-RLS adaptive filter
Shepherd and McWhirter proposed a QRD-RLS algorithm for adaptive filtering with linear constraints. In this paper, the numerical properties of this algorithm are considered. In particular, it is shown that the computed weight vector satisfies a set of constraints which are perturbed from the original ones, the amount of perturbation being dependent on the wordlength.
